Add and configure a stored variable

It is good practice to create stored variables in a single Applications folder under the System Configuration folder. This makes it easier to edit and maintain stored variables.
To create a stored variable folder
-
Right-click the System Configuration folder, point to Add Item, then Standard Items, then select Applications Folder. A new Applications folder appears.
-
Rename the folder to Stored Variables.

To add a stored variable
-
Right-click the Stored Variables folder, point to Add Item, point to Variables, then click Stored Variable. A new Stored variable appears.

-
Rename the stored variable. This is the name that is to refer to the Stored Variable from elsewhere in the project.
-
Configure the properties. For guidance in configuring the properties, see Stored variable properties.
Important: When you finish setting the properties, Validate and Save the project.
